St Francis Hospital
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 512,217,872 | 483,501,282 | 28,716,590 | 13.0 | 43% |
| 2012 | 522,722,961 | 482,325,076 | 40,397,885 | 14.0 | 43% |
| 2013 | 555,542,901 | 515,733,888 | 39,809,013 | 14.5 | 41% |
| 2014 | 581,550,014 | 533,081,195 | 48,468,819 | 14.9 | 42% |
| 2015 | 614,209,538 | 576,325,850 | 37,883,688 | 14.3 | 41% |
| 2016 | 686,511,848 | 631,006,475 | 55,505,373 | 14.5 | 38% |
| 2017 | 755,137,322 | 679,110,268 | 76,027,054 | 15.2 | 35% |
| 2018 | 803,386,244 | 728,308,479 | 75,077,765 | 14.4 | 35% |
| 2019 | 868,766,076 | 815,024,113 | 53,741,963 | 14.4 | 32% |
| 2020 | 834,224,682 | 825,918,296 | 8,306,386 | 15.2 | 33% |
| 2021 | 944,137,253 | 821,603,797 | 122,533,456 | 18.2 | 34% |
| 2022 | 969,845,898 | 860,471,717 | 109,374,181 | 16.9 | 34% |
| 2023 | 960,215,027 | 911,251,909 | 48,963,118 | 17.6 | 34%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ization brought in $48,963,118 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 17.6 months of spending, up from 13 in 2011. Staff pay was 34% of spending. $4,209,945 of its net assets are donor-restricted.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ash.
